Transaction 4ae690c7906e6d4bc88796205c46ca2dee7e3b69f2d6d6554d1fbf722231e3dc

block
fd5186c9b113b0bab6a907df158f9e16caca93fbb28cc81f1ef7c99784eede3d

2 Inputs

993 Outputs